Hello everyone,

We are using Linphone pretty successfully with video. The version I have is somewhat removed from the Linphone CVS. However, I plan to try to contribute as many fixes as I can identify.

In the file coreapi/osipuacb.c there are two instances where audio_rtp_port is listed instead of video_rtp_port. Clearly a cut and paste error. This patch corrects that. The patch is relative to 0.12.1. I have pasted it below as well as included it as an attachment so you can use whichever is easier.
